PARLIAMENTARY EARLY DAY MOTION
MIND'S ACCESS ALL AGES CAMPAIGN (9 October 2005)
Motion Details
That this House recognises the mental health needs of an ageing population as set out in Mind's Access All Ages campaign; supports Mind's calls for the Government to act now to combat discrimination and stigma around mental health in later life, to promote positive mental well-being as people age, to ensure that older people have equal access to the same level and quality of support and treatment available to other age groups, that treatment choice is a right not a gamble for older people with mental health issues and that if people experience mental distress in later life they are supported by people who have expertise in mental health care; and further supports Mind's call to ensure that people who seek treatment for mental distress in later life are properly consulted and informed about any treatments they undertake, to promote planning for mental health needs as a core element of preparation for later life and to ensure that people with mental health problems, who are experts in their own conditions, are involved in all decisions about their own care and treatment, whatever their age.
